Your message dated Sat, 12 Apr 2014 01:05:03 +0000
with message-id <[email protected]>
and subject line Bug#744183: fixed in movit 1.1-2
has caused the Debian Bug report #744183,
regarding libmovit2 and libmovit1: error when trying to install together
to be marked as done.
This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.
(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act [email protected]
immediately.)
--
744183: http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=744183
Debian Bug Tracking System
Contact [email protected] with problems
--- Begin Message ---
Package: libmovit1,libmovit2
Version: libmovit1/1.0.3-1
Version: libmovit2/1.1-1
Severity: serious
User: [email protected]
Usertags: edos-file-overwrite
Date: 2014-04-11
Architecture: amd64
Distribution: sid
Hi,
automatic installation tests of packages that share a file and at the
same time do not conflict by their package dependency relationships has
detected the following problem:
Extracting templates from packages: 93%
Extracting templates from packages: 100%
Preconfiguring packages ...
Selecting previously unselected package libdrm2:amd64.
(Reading database ... 10937 files and directories currently installed.)
Preparing to unpack .../libdrm2_2.4.52-1_amd64.deb ...
Unpacking libdrm2:amd64 (2.4.52-1) ...
Selecting previously unselected package libgomp1:amd64.
Preparing to unpack .../libgomp1_4.8.2-19_amd64.deb ...
Unpacking libgomp1:amd64 (4.8.2-19) ...
Selecting previously unselected package libfftw3-double3:amd64.
Preparing to unpack .../libfftw3-double3_3.3.4-1_amd64.deb ...
Unpacking libfftw3-double3:amd64 (3.3.4-1) ...
Selecting previously unselected package libglapi-mesa:amd64.
Preparing to unpack .../libglapi-mesa_10.1.0-5_amd64.deb ...
Unpacking libglapi-mesa:amd64 (10.1.0-5) ...
Selecting previously unselected package libxau6:amd64.
Preparing to unpack .../libxau6_1%3a1.0.8-1_amd64.deb ...
Unpacking libxau6:amd64 (1:1.0.8-1) ...
Selecting previously unselected package libxdmcp6:amd64.
Preparing to unpack .../libxdmcp6_1%3a1.1.1-1_amd64.deb ...
Unpacking libxdmcp6:amd64 (1:1.1.1-1) ...
Selecting previously unselected package libxcb1:amd64.
Preparing to unpack .../libxcb1_1.10-2_amd64.deb ...
Unpacking libxcb1:amd64 (1.10-2) ...
Selecting previously unselected package libx11-data.
Preparing to unpack .../libx11-data_2%3a1.6.2-1_all.deb ...
Unpacking libx11-data (2:1.6.2-1) ...
Selecting previously unselected package libx11-6:amd64.
Preparing to unpack .../libx11-6_2%3a1.6.2-1_amd64.deb ...
Unpacking libx11-6:amd64 (2:1.6.2-1) ...
Selecting previously unselected package libx11-xcb1:amd64.
Preparing to unpack .../libx11-xcb1_2%3a1.6.2-1_amd64.deb ...
Unpacking libx11-xcb1:amd64 (2:1.6.2-1) ...
Selecting previously unselected package libxcb-dri2-0:amd64.
Preparing to unpack .../libxcb-dri2-0_1.10-2_amd64.deb ...
Unpacking libxcb-dri2-0:amd64 (1.10-2) ...
Selecting previously unselected package libxcb-dri3-0:amd64.
Preparing to unpack .../libxcb-dri3-0_1.10-2_amd64.deb ...
Unpacking libxcb-dri3-0:amd64 (1.10-2) ...
Selecting previously unselected package libxcb-glx0:amd64.
Preparing to unpack .../libxcb-glx0_1.10-2_amd64.deb ...
Unpacking libxcb-glx0:amd64 (1.10-2) ...
Selecting previously unselected package libxcb-present0:amd64.
Preparing to unpack .../libxcb-present0_1.10-2_amd64.deb ...
Unpacking libxcb-present0:amd64 (1.10-2) ...
Selecting previously unselected package libxcb-sync1:amd64.
Preparing to unpack .../libxcb-sync1_1.10-2_amd64.deb ...
Unpacking libxcb-sync1:amd64 (1.10-2) ...
Selecting previously unselected package libxfixes3:amd64.
Preparing to unpack .../libxfixes3_1%3a5.0.1-1_amd64.deb ...
Unpacking libxfixes3:amd64 (1:5.0.1-1) ...
Selecting previously unselected package libxdamage1:amd64.
Preparing to unpack .../libxdamage1_1%3a1.1.4-1_amd64.deb ...
Unpacking libxdamage1:amd64 (1:1.1.4-1) ...
Selecting previously unselected package libxext6:amd64.
Preparing to unpack .../libxext6_2%3a1.3.2-1_amd64.deb ...
Unpacking libxext6:amd64 (2:1.3.2-1) ...
Selecting previously unselected package libxshmfence1:amd64.
Preparing to unpack .../libxshmfence1_1.1-2_amd64.deb ...
Unpacking libxshmfence1:amd64 (1.1-2) ...
Selecting previously unselected package libxxf86vm1:amd64.
Preparing to unpack .../libxxf86vm1_1%3a1.1.3-1_amd64.deb ...
Unpacking libxxf86vm1:amd64 (1:1.1.3-1) ...
Selecting previously unselected package libgl1-mesa-glx:amd64.
Preparing to unpack .../libgl1-mesa-glx_10.1.0-5_amd64.deb ...
Unpacking libgl1-mesa-glx:amd64 (10.1.0-5) ...
Selecting previously unselected package libxi6:amd64.
Preparing to unpack .../libxi6_2%3a1.7.2-1_amd64.deb ...
Unpacking libxi6:amd64 (2:1.7.2-1) ...
Selecting previously unselected package x11-common.
Preparing to unpack .../x11-common_1%3a7.7+7_all.deb ...
Unpacking x11-common (1:7.7+7) ...
Selecting previously unselected package libice6:amd64.
Preparing to unpack .../libice6_2%3a1.0.8-2_amd64.deb ...
Unpacking libice6:amd64 (2:1.0.8-2) ...
Selecting previously unselected package libsm6:amd64.
Preparing to unpack .../libsm6_2%3a1.2.1-2_amd64.deb ...
Unpacking libsm6:amd64 (2:1.2.1-2) ...
Selecting previously unselected package libxt6:amd64.
Preparing to unpack .../libxt6_1%3a1.1.4-1_amd64.deb ...
Unpacking libxt6:amd64 (1:1.1.4-1) ...
Selecting previously unselected package libxmu6:amd64.
Preparing to unpack .../libxmu6_2%3a1.1.1-1_amd64.deb ...
Unpacking libxmu6:amd64 (2:1.1.1-1) ...
Selecting previously unselected package libglew1.10:amd64.
Preparing to unpack .../libglew1.10_1.10.0-3_amd64.deb ...
Unpacking libglew1.10:amd64 (1.10.0-3) ...
Selecting previously unselected package libglu1-mesa:amd64.
Preparing to unpack .../libglu1-mesa_9.0.0-2_amd64.deb ...
Unpacking libglu1-mesa:amd64 (9.0.0-2) ...
Selecting previously unselected package libmovit1.
Preparing to unpack .../libmovit1_1.0.3-1_amd64.deb ...
Unpacking libmovit1 (1.0.3-1) ...
Selecting previously unselected package libepoxy0.
Preparing to unpack .../libepoxy0_1.1-1_amd64.deb ...
Unpacking libepoxy0 (1.1-1) ...
Selecting previously unselected package libmovit2.
Preparing to unpack .../libmovit2_1.1-1_amd64.deb ...
Unpacking libmovit2 (1.1-1) ...
dpkg: error processing archive
/var/cache/apt/archives/libmovit2_1.1-1_amd64.deb (--unpack):
trying to overwrite '/usr/share/movit/mirror_effect.frag', which is also in
package libmovit1 1.0.3-1
dpkg-deb: error: subprocess paste was killed by signal (Broken pipe)
Processing triggers for man-db (2.6.7.1-1) ...
Errors were encountered while processing:
/var/cache/apt/archives/libmovit2_1.1-1_amd64.deb
E: Sub-process /usr/bin/dpkg returned an error code (1)
This is a serious bug as it makes installation fail, and violates
sections 7.6.1 and 10.1 of the policy. An optimal solution would
consist in only one of the packages installing that file, and renaming
or removing the file in the other package. Depending on the
circumstances you might also consider Replace relations or file
diversions. If the conflicting situation cannot be resolved then, as a
last resort, the two packages have to declare a mutual
Conflict. Please take into account that Replaces, Conflicts and
diversions should only be used when packages provide different
implementations for the same functionality.
Here is a list of files that are known to be shared by both packages
(according to the Contents file for sid/amd64, which may be
slightly out of sync):
/usr/share/movit/alpha_division_effect.frag
/usr/share/movit/alpha_multiplication_effect.frag
/usr/share/movit/blur_effect.frag
/usr/share/movit/colorspace_conversion_effect.frag
/usr/share/movit/complex_modulate_effect.frag
/usr/share/movit/deconvolution_sharpen_effect.frag
/usr/share/movit/dither_effect.frag
/usr/share/movit/fft_pass_effect.frag
/usr/share/movit/flat_input.frag
/usr/share/movit/footer.frag
/usr/share/movit/gamma_compression_effect.frag
/usr/share/movit/gamma_expansion_effect.frag
/usr/share/movit/header.frag
/usr/share/movit/highlight_cutoff_effect.frag
/usr/share/movit/lift_gamma_gain_effect.frag
/usr/share/movit/luma_mix_effect.frag
/usr/share/movit/mirror_effect.frag
/usr/share/movit/mix_effect.frag
/usr/share/movit/multiply_effect.frag
/usr/share/movit/overlay_effect.frag
/usr/share/movit/overlay_matte_effect.frag
/usr/share/movit/padding_effect.frag
/usr/share/movit/resample_effect.frag
/usr/share/movit/sandbox_effect.frag
/usr/share/movit/saturation_effect.frag
/usr/share/movit/slice_effect.frag
/usr/share/movit/texture1d.frag
/usr/share/movit/vignette_effect.frag
/usr/share/movit/vs.vert
/usr/share/movit/white_balance_effect.frag
/usr/share/movit/ycbcr_input.frag
This bug has been filed against both packages. If you, the maintainers of
the two packages in question, have agreed on which of the packages will
resolve the problem please reassign the bug to that package. You may then
also register in the BTS that the other package is affected by the bug.
-Ralf.
PS: for more information about the detection of file overwrite errors
of this kind see http://edos.debian.net/file-overwrites/.
--- End Message ---
--- Begin Message ---
Source: movit
Source-Version: 1.1-2
We believe that the bug you reported is fixed in the latest version of
movit, which is due to be installed in the Debian FTP archive.
A summary of the changes between this version and the previous one is
attached.
Thank you for reporting the bug, which will now be closed. If you
have further comments please address them to [email protected],
and the maintainer will reopen the bug report if appropriate.
Debian distribution maintenance software
pp.
Steinar H. Gunderson <[email protected]> (supplier of updated movit package)
(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ing [email protected])
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A256
Format: 1.8
Date: Sat, 12 Apr 2014 02:37:35 +0200
Source: movit
Binary: libmovit-dev libmovit2
Architecture: source amd64
Version: 1.1-2
Distribution: unstable
Urgency: high
Maintainer: Steinar H. Gunderson <[email protected]>
Changed-By: Steinar H. Gunderson <[email protected]>
Description:
libmovit-dev - GPU video filter library - development files
libmovit2 - GPU video filter library
Closes: 744183
Changes:
movit (1.1-2) unstable; urgency=high
.
* urgency=high, fixed an RC bug.
* Add Conflicts: libmovit1 to libmovit2, since they ship overlapping
shader files. Longer term, maybe we would want to do something
to allow keeping multiple versions around, but this is the simplest
thing for now, especially with no reverse dependencies. (Closes: #744183)
* Make libmovit2 Multi-Arch: same, so that e.g. i386 and amd64 versions
can be coinstalled.
Checksums-Sha1:
99a30535f124d98753ae9f5b9064af24195e1a4f 1788 movit_1.1-2.dsc
0385c671fc50832b711143f1f01bbd2320a3e747 2804 movit_1.1-2.debian.tar.xz
24d88ba06d63e83655604943f665b75149c44542 180164 libmovit-dev_1.1-2_amd64.deb
e3a2be76516a1d7aaaa25571eda645fda9e2fa97 131920 libmovit2_1.1-2_amd64.deb
Checksums-Sha256:
d232d51692d74e7f647e2333341792f8c516380008d825828bdb631f14bc8c9d 1788
movit_1.1-2.dsc
311ff097beed7ceca03ab260afa9c591e1ad69ed6a4c3b8bce5792cbe0993e12 2804
movit_1.1-2.debian.tar.xz
b54189e3e129c68fe6692975e2b8c3134ec4eaa763200ee978569a36c6373513 180164
libmovit-dev_1.1-2_amd64.deb
6f4e1c168aea1a83b8d6076600757d559106089cdda00b93fcf83afc5364212d 131920
libmovit2_1.1-2_amd64.deb
Files:
41f697cb9ff03f45d25c5b90ea0853cf 1788 libs optional movit_1.1-2.dsc
e3354475171ae7e786f607d623a5099e 2804 libs optional movit_1.1-2.debian.tar.xz
47914d166b25f605b38945a9f405bd59 180164 libdevel optional
libmovit-dev_1.1-2_amd64.deb
320b82b8f3a830f18c0814f18baa58c1 131920 libs optional libmovit2_1.1-2_amd64.deb
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1
iQIcBAEBCAAGBQJTSI28AAoJEH9hdWF3l492988QAJWFJbzWSven8XJSBCbmy3We
rm7q6z5rQaBQLqBgaSp/WVQcwytC8xQOBaLdHADrBTuhl8RY9ThTd7Ti6/MNphgW
wHLdzAR2QF4tcpDonTWKT+TOi05NQuQHllIOh/TXCi/b0/TV8ozGBvntDNJ2iF0K
DDhdqOPOD8edSGq/oRJap592Xs9gKWHLqDr62KZQ7yiPeJEr1lWMD8i6/EOaBHe9
CiCqENC8y9WyUYTPXZf+hscWIW88Fbj8E2kZO9GgzBsuTrHF7ExSrlKP/VYYkIoj
+CMbWLFC3WR4Jr8D5wYfwF4Y/qkgInCtqFkDuCQbhIrKj73d/CuAUxO2A6S4jMja
iY5NgyDMQeoOdmVX9lBWyLCEGPdaBBOrErnFkBcwnGDaLQmpJQSiTGRwFC6IfdbC
Dl76ZtdmQWBLbjGuvhWAxs0FSHBqTAdE2WK9LdRvUW1YWjw+mjTWZCQS7LXr5NG9
NpGb2VdyCj0PEuJaz+sfWJkhSFRRAfNGOiJGFZRMe5HCbCGko3UObAnTISv2fP7o
4lkytwK7Mn2PWMdvzqM1gaKMLRGsLrVtCajuE6ImkVludWM+NT3U19FWnPQqxVhQ
C2phTxooX8p4LA4uoR+FYxz3DmDvEEiZjEd+bmsUyb6c7t1Vz/6VqO+awqnqv+Pj
G1171uq78BKg5T1YD2Xe
=+zue
-----END PGP SIGNATURE-----
--- End Message ---